Explore the nuances of building clay wares by hand! This class will give you a head start into the endless possibilities of handbuilding. Skills learned will prepare you to create both pots and sculpture, and help you understand how to use tools and techniques to create safe-to-fire forms of all kinds. Learning will include essential techniques like proper scoring and joining, as well as foundational building methods like pinch, slab, coil-building, and combined building.
